Washington Square, Syracuse, NY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Washington Square?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Washington Square Studio Apartments | $1,000 | $1,000 | $1,000 |
| Washington Square 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,320 | $1,050 | $1,600 |
| Washington Square 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,781 | $900 | $3,200 |
| Washington Square 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,025 | $1,400 | $3,000 |
